The 1907 Cork Senior Hurling Championship was the 20th staging of the Cork Senior Hurling Championship since its establishment by the Cork County Board in 1887.

St. Finbarr's were the defending champions.
Dungourney won the championship following a 5â17 to 0â3 defeat of Castletownroche in the final.[1] This was their second championship title overall and their first title in five championship seasons.
